<html>
 <body>
  <div style="font-family: Verdana, Arial, Helvetica, Sans-Serif;">
   <table bgcolor="#f9f3c9" width="100%" cellpadding="8" style="border: 1px #c9c399 solid;">
    <tr>
     <td>
      This is an automatically generated e-mail. To reply, visit:
      <a href="http://git.reviewboard.kde.org/r/113011/">http://git.reviewboard.kde.org/r/113011/</a>
     </td>
    </tr>
   </table>
   <br />











<div>




<table width="100%" border="0" bgcolor="white" style="border: 1px solid #C0C0C0; border-collapse: collapse; margin: 2px padding: 2px;">
 <thead>
  <tr>
   <th colspan="4" bgcolor="#F0F0F0" style="border-bottom: 1px solid #C0C0C0; font-size: 9pt; padding: 4px 8px; text-align: left;">
    <a href="http://git.reviewboard.kde.org/r/113011/diff/1/?file=193226#file193226line25" style="color: black; font-weight: bold; text-decoration: underline;">kmymoney/mymoney/mymoneytransaction.cpp</a>
    <span style="font-weight: normal;">

     (Diff revision 1)

    </span>
   </th>
  </tr>
 </thead>



 
 

 <tbody>

  <tr>
    <th bgcolor="#b1ebb0" style="border-right: 1px solid #C0C0C0;" align="right"><font size="2"></font></th>
    <td bgcolor="#c5ffc4" width="50%"><pre style="font-size: 8pt; line-height: 140%; margin: 0; "></pre></td>
    <th bgcolor="#b1ebb0" style="border-left: 1px solid #C0C0C0; border-right: 1px solid #C0C0C0;" align="right"><font size="2">25</font></th>
    <td bgcolor="#c5ffc4" width="50%"><pre style="font-size: 8pt; line-height: 140%; margin: 0; "><span class="cp">#include <mymoneyfile.h></span></pre></td>
  </tr>

 </tbody>

</table>

<pre style="margin-left: 2em; white-space: pre-wrap; white-space: -moz-pre-wrap; white-space: -pre-wrap; white-space: -o-pre-wrap; word-wrap: break-word;">MyMoneyTransaction should not use anything from MyMoneyFile.</pre>
</div>
<br />

<div>




<table width="100%" border="0" bgcolor="white" style="border: 1px solid #C0C0C0; border-collapse: collapse; margin: 2px padding: 2px;">
 <thead>
  <tr>
   <th colspan="4" bgcolor="#F0F0F0" style="border-bottom: 1px solid #C0C0C0; font-size: 9pt; padding: 4px 8px; text-align: left;">
    <a href="http://git.reviewboard.kde.org/r/113011/diff/1/?file=193226#file193226line131" style="color: black; font-weight: bold; text-decoration: underline;">kmymoney/mymoney/mymoneytransaction.cpp</a>
    <span style="font-weight: normal;">

     (Diff revision 1)

    </span>
   </th>
  </tr>
 </thead>



 
 

 <tbody>

  <tr>
    <th bgcolor="#b1ebb0" style="border-right: 1px solid #C0C0C0;" align="right"><font size="2"></font></th>
    <td bgcolor="#c5ffc4" width="50%"><pre style="font-size: 8pt; line-height: 140%; margin: 0; "></pre></td>
    <th bgcolor="#b1ebb0" style="border-left: 1px solid #C0C0C0; border-right: 1px solid #C0C0C0;" align="right"><font size="2">130</font></th>
    <td bgcolor="#c5ffc4" width="50%"><pre style="font-size: 8pt; line-height: 140%; margin: 0; "><span class="kt">bool</span> <span class="n">MyMoneyTransaction</span><span class="o">::</span><span class="n">addVATSplit</span><span class="p">(</span><span class="k">const</span> <span class="n">MyMoneyAccount</span> <span class="o">&</span><span class="n">account</span><span class="p">,</span> <span class="k">const</span> <span class="n">MyMoneyAccount</span> <span class="o">&</span><span class="n">category</span><span class="p">,</span> <span class="k">const</span> <span class="n">MyMoneyMoney</span> <span class="o">&</span><span class="n">amount</span><span class="p">)</span></pre></td>
  </tr>

 </tbody>

</table>

<pre style="margin-left: 2em; white-space: pre-wrap; white-space: -moz-pre-wrap; white-space: -pre-wrap; white-space: -o-pre-wrap; word-wrap: break-word;">Please move this kind of logic to MyMoneyFile. MyMoneyTransaction should not use anything from MyMoneyFile. Possible signature:

  bool MyMoneyFile::addVATSplit(MyMoneyTransaction&, const MyMoneyAccount& account, const MyMoneyAccount& category, const MyMoneyMoney& amount);
</pre>
</div>
<br />



<p>- Thomas Baumgart</p>


<br />
<p>On November 9th, 2013, 11:38 p.m. CET, Ralf Habacker wrote:</p>








<table bgcolor="#fefadf" width="100%" cellspacing="0" cellpadding="8" style="background-image: url('http://git.reviewboard.kde.org/static/rb/images/review_request_box_top_bg.ab6f3b1072c9.png'); background-position: left top; background-repeat: repeat-x; border: 1px black solid;">
 <tr>
  <td>

<div>Review request for KMymoney and Cristian Oneț.</div>
<div>By Ralf Habacker.</div>


<p style="color: grey;"><i>Updated Nov. 9, 2013, 11:38 p.m.</i></p>







<div style="margin-top: 1.5em;">
 <b style="color: #575012; font-size: 10pt; margin-top: 1.5em;">Bugs: </b>


 <a href="http://bugs.kde.org/show_bug.cgi?id=241322">241322</a>


</div>



<div style="margin-top: 1.5em;">
 <b style="color: #575012; font-size: 10pt;">Repository: </b>
kmymoney
</div>


<h1 style="color: #575012; font-size: 10pt; margin-top: 1.5em;">Description </h1>
 <table width="100%" bgcolor="#ffffff" cellspacing="0" cellpadding="10" style="border: 1px solid #b8b5a0">
 <tr>
  <td>
   <pre style="margin: 0; padding: 0; white-space: pre-wrap; white-space: -moz-pre-wrap; white-space: -pre-wrap; white-space: -o-pre-wrap; word-wrap: break-word;">Add VAT split to file import.
</pre>
  </td>
 </tr>
</table>


<h1 style="color: #575012; font-size: 10pt; margin-top: 1.5em;">Testing </h1>
<table width="100%" bgcolor="#ffffff" cellspacing="0" cellpadding="10" style="border: 1px solid #b8b5a0">
 <tr>
  <td>
   <pre style="margin: 0; padding: 0; white-space: pre-wrap; white-space: -moz-pre-wrap; white-space: -pre-wrap; white-space: -o-pre-wrap; word-wrap: break-word;">1. created new kmymoney file using skr03 standard accounts 
2. enable "VAT account" account 1775 "Umsatzsteuer 19%" and entered 19 as vat percents
3. added account 1775 as automatic vat assignment accounts to account 8400 "Erlöse"
4. added payee "Warenverkauf" with auto assignment to account 8400 
5. imported some transactions from csv file for account 1200 "Bankkonto" using the payee defined in step 4.
date,nr,expense,income,payee
14.02.2012,2,,"259,99",Warenverkauf
25.03.2012,3,,"49,99",Warenverkauf
25.06.2012,4,,"709,99",Warenverkauf

Afterwards ledger contains transactions with correct vat split.
</pre>
  </td>
 </tr>
</table>


<h1 style="color: #575012; font-size: 10pt; margin-top: 1.5em;">Diffs</b> </h1>
<ul style="margin-left: 3em; padding-left: 0;">

 <li>kmymoney/converter/mymoneystatementreader.cpp <span style="color: grey">(f41b0cfe079c0c5238b43c56c66ea216d028901a)</span></li>

 <li>kmymoney/dialogs/transactioneditor.cpp <span style="color: grey">(cfb0f71b255e948dcbda7a2b57178da44cc7d0b4)</span></li>

 <li>kmymoney/mymoney/mymoneytransaction.h <span style="color: grey">(9dc18151c8cc540f71ebc5cdc1a818168212e610)</span></li>

 <li>kmymoney/mymoney/mymoneytransaction.cpp <span style="color: grey">(fdb0618f18bb21b0663d3a4985aae1239d0e7bc6)</span></li>

</ul>

<p><a href="http://git.reviewboard.kde.org/r/113011/diff/" style="margin-left: 3em;">View Diff</a></p>







  </td>
 </tr>
</table>








  </div>
 </body>
</html>